What is the equation to calculate the total cost, c, of a phone call that lasts m minutes, given a base charge of $3.00 and $0.15 per minute?

Back

c = 3.00 + 0.15m

If a printer can print 10 pages per minute and there are already 35 pages in the tray, how can we express the total pages printed after m minutes?

Back

10m + 35 = total pages printed

Samuel bought 3 tires for $79.95 each and some rims for $59 each, spending a total of $534.85. What equation can be used to find the number of rims, r, he bought?

Back

3(79.95) + 59r = 534.85
